In the past four years, the number of foreclosed homes in the country swelled as homeowners and builders could not make their mortgage payments. This led lenders to repossess their properties in order to get their money back.
This glut in the housing sector drove down the prices of homes, even way below their market values. Many homeowners and builders found themselves squeezed out and having their credit ratings marred.
There are two sides of the coin in this crisis: devastation on the part of the homeowners, real estate developers, and the lenders themselves as they struggled to dispose of these nonperforming assets in a bad housing market; and opportunities for those who have the cash and business sense to grab these potential money-making properties at depressed prices.
Simple Missteps
Foreclosed homes start out simply as this: Some homeowners who found themselves out of their wits end in figuring out how to pay for their mortgages ignore letters of notice from their lenders. But they didn't know that simply ignoring and pretending that everything will work out just fine is exactly what would lead to the foreclosure of their homes. They could have communicated with their lenders as soon as possible and informed them of the problems in making payments. With clear financial information, they could have renegotiated their terms or other options would have been offered to them.
They could also have sought the assistance of a housing counseling agency that could have provided them with information on public and private agencies that offered services to alleviate their troubles. Some of these services include credit counseling.
By seeking professional help, homeowners could avoid having their properties listed in foreclosed homes for sale. Alte
atives can be given to them, like renegotiation of the terms of their loan depending on their financial situation; a grace period for mortgage payments until they have bounced back and take on the loan payments again, and making partial claims and execution of promissory notes.
Other routes which may result to losing their houses, but with their credit rating intact, include pre-foreclosure sale or voluntarily surrendering their properties to the lender if the pre-foreclosure sale was not successful. Either way, they would find their houses in the list of foreclosed homes for sale, but at least their financial future would not be as sticky as it would have been if they really faced eviction due to real estate repossession.
